搬家了,原来的blog.nowans.com将要搬到这个新家了,移民国外。
用上worldpress,发现一切这么的自然和简单。很不错,新的起点从这里开始…
从我用gtalk开始,一直碰到这么个问题,gtalk在windows2003 下占用大量内存,一般都在80M以上,经常飙到100M以上。感觉很奇怪,还以为被木马感染了,在winXP下一般最小化状态在10M以下。偶然在 google talk的论坛中也发现了有人碰到这样的问题,但是一直没有解决,google talk更新了几次,还是依旧。
昨天台式机换了一个DVD-ROM,启动后系统变得爆慢无比,进XP都花了近10 分钟,想想也是1G内存,没道理啊。想到CMOS里刚才并没有显示有光驱,进入系统后,也没有光驱。显然线接错了,检查后发现居然接在了硬盘线上,靠,这 都能启动。但是就是这一下接错,就出现了一个新的问题。当我接回正确的线后,启动系统,比刚才好点,但是还是慢,而且异常的卡,开风行看电影卡,装软件 卡,迅雷下载卡,几乎启动什么程序cpu都要上100%。
接下来就是摸索过程,CMOS设置里捣鼓了一番,因为CMOS没电了,换光驱的时候顺便换了电池,我怀疑这里设置问题。又拔了软盘,显卡一一测试,故障依旧。
没招了,上GOOGLE查,经过一番搜索后,看见了一个原因。XP会自动改变硬盘的DMA模式,当硬盘校验出错的时候。右键 “我的电脑”-“设备管理器”
展开“IDE ATA/ATAPI 控制器”节点, 双击“主要IDE控制器”,果然显示PIO 模式。NND,原因出在这里,删除主要IDE控制器的驱动,重启,自动会发现新硬件,安装驱动,再重启,故障解决。
这里有一篇详细的文章:
CSS的编码不对的时候,在firefox下可以正常显示,但是在IE6下会使CSS失效。
今天碰到,着实让我郁闷了好一会,后来想到aptana写的CSS是utf8的,转换成GB2312后显示正常。我开始还以为标签漏了或者注释引起的。呵呵
后来还改错了文件夹,改了其他的CSS文件的编码,绕了好大的圈子。
昨天装上nginx后在高负载的时候,论坛上传图片或者执行较长时间脚本的时候就不停的出现502 Bad Gateway ,网上搜了,大多数都是张大师的那篇解决方案,他的解决方案是
http
{
……
fastcgi_connect_timeout 300;
fastcgi_send_timeout 300;
fastcgi_read_timeout 300;
……
}
增加了fastcgi的相应请求时间。但是我在实际中碰到了这个问题,设置到500,还是会出现,只是比我设置120的时候要少一些。后来发现主要是在一些post或者数据库操作的时候出现这种情况,静态页面是不会出现的。
反复的查问题,调试,也加大了CGI的进程数。
nowa架了一个GitHost,也就是一个源码管理的服务器。git服务器目前国内比较少,因为git本来就用在linux下的原因吧。
刚上手是不好掌握的,应该说要比SVN高级那么一点点。
来看看怎么初步用起来吧。
终于看完了50集的《李小龙传奇》,从人物传记来说,总体还是不错的。这部片子描述的李小龙并非一个完人,他也有很多缺点,冲动,狂妄,大手大脚花 钱,固执。但是对于他的成就,观众还是可以容忍这些缺点的。毕竟是我的偶像啊。片子也有一些不爽的地方,有些地方显得李小龙太不近人情了,还有就是可笑的 一个美国人一个手就打败了李小龙,大概编剧为了显示天外有天,人外有人。
李小龙的武术思想和习武精神值得我们敬佩的,对我们学习程序设计也很有帮助。
由于原来http服务配置是apache2+php5 在prefork下用mod_php运行的,效率非常的低,当httpd进程达到1024以上就变得非常的缓慢。后来我尝试了装nginx,但是在远程服 务器上传附件上显示空白,其实后来在配置apache2的worker模式下的fastcgid时也出现这个问题,就发现了并不是nginx的配置问题, 而是问题出在php上。
首先安装了 apache2.2.9 编译用了worker方式。模块用动态加载,全装了进去,再一个个加,我并不确定到底要多少模块,这也是对apache的模块并不很熟悉,它的定制性高。
nginx的性能已经超越了lighttpd,lighttpd如果在动态上承载量大的话,我也许会考虑,nginx据说能达到上万的并发连接,提供了稳定的服务及强大的反向代理。
最近管理的一个网站 http://mall.bianz.com ,一直是apache在跑,也没有用fast-cgi.性能很是稳定,在并发1000连接以上就影响访问速度了,1500的时候就很卡了,会有超时问题。
对比了几个强壮的web服务器配置,决定先用nginx试试。昨天根据http://blog.s135.com/read.php/366.htm?page=1的文章终于成功的配置了nginx,能够比较顺利的跑起来了。
但是还缺少rewrite配置,nginx的中文资料还比较少。大多是俄语的
http://wiki.codemongers.com/NginxChs
这里有一个中文wiki。
JS的继承应该有很多种实现方式。
最常用的是原型继承。
function parentClass(){
method () { }
}
function subClass (){
method2(){}
}
subClass.propotype =new parentClass;
subClass.propotype.constructor=subClass;
这样subClass就继承了parentClass
JS的怪异语法真让我头疼,什么时候JS也正规一点。
由 WordPress 所驱动